Apostolic Society

  The Apostolic Society supports the Mission activity of the Church. We are a group whose work is the making of Vestments and Altar linen for the missions. Gifts of material or wedding dresses are acceptable if they are suitable for the making of vestments. The association purchases equipment for the missions such as Mass Books, chalices, etc.,.
